Transaction 322e4bec0131b572ae20c56afa30072aff20f8bc8561cbbd2c781f83da5d8063

1 Input
2 Outputs
  • 322e4bec0131b572ae20c56afa30072aff20f8bc8561cbbd2c781f83da5d8063:0
  • value  2374675
    address  355qYZsTsDUBkrWPH4pxp1RGd1SA69S7Kd
  • 322e4bec0131b572ae20c56afa30072aff20f8bc8561cbbd2c781f83da5d8063:1
  • value  151728184
    address  37dEdcBeQBVAcdFMgZmfnESwwotxrUGUdo